Html và css có thể được sử dụng cùng nhau không?

Vì vậy, tôi chắc chắn rằng bạn đã nghe những từ viết tắt này được tung ra trong vài năm qua nhưng có thể bạn không chắc làm thế nào và tại sao chúng lại song hành với nhau trong thế giới phát triển web

HTML

HyperText Markup Language is the standard markup language for creating web pages. Using the concept of tags, which are essentially different elements, HTML describes the structure of a page so the browser knows how to display the content. An element is defined by a start tag (e.g.

), content and an end tag (e.g.

).




Page Title <------ This is what a tag looks like!


Heading


Paragraph



CSS

Cascading Style Sheets là ngôn ngữ biểu định kiểu được sử dụng để mô tả cách hiển thị nội dung được xác định bởi mã HTML trong trình duyệt. Nói cách khác, nó được sử dụng để tạo kiểu cho các phần tử HTML. Bạn có thể tạo kiểu theo phần tử (1), lớp (2) hoặc id (3)

(1)div {
background-color: grey;
color: red;
width: 10px;
font-size: 12px;
}
(2).textArea {
background-color: grey;
color: red;
width: 300px;
font-size: 12px;
}
(3)#simpleButton {
width: 100px;
font-size: 12px;
border-radius: 15px;
}
Javascript

Javascript là ngôn ngữ lập trình được sử dụng để kiểm soát cách một trang web cụ thể hoạt động. Nó thường được sử dụng để thêm một lớp tương tác vào trang web

function add(num1, num2) {
return num1 + num2;
}

Vì vậy, bây giờ chúng tôi biết cách mô tả cấu trúc của trang (HTML), sửa đổi giao diện của nội dung (CSS) và kiểm soát hành vi của các phần tử (JS) làm cho trang web trở nên ‘tương tác’ hơn

Chúng có thể được kết hợp thành một trang hoặc chia thành ba tệp khác nhau (. html,. css và. js)

Vì vậy, hãy tạo một trang web nhanh có chứa một nút tương tác mà khi được nhấp vào sẽ hiển thị văn bản màu đỏ bên dưới nút đó




Interactive Button







Kết hợp cả ba trên một trang được coi là một cách làm không tốt, đó là lý do tại sao bạn sẽ thấy các dự án chứa các thư mục chứa các tệp HTML, CSS và Javascript được chia nhỏ

Ngày nay, các nhà phát triển web hiếm khi sử dụng từ ‘vanilla’ (tôi. e. mã đơn giản không có khung/plugin/phụ thuộc) HTML, CSS hoặc Javascript. Thay vào đó, họ sử dụng các framework như Angular, React hoặc Vue cung cấp một bộ công cụ và giúp tạo mã mạnh mẽ hơn và dễ bảo trì hơn. Họ cũng sử dụng một DOM ảo vừa nhanh hơn vừa hiệu quả hơn trên quy mô lớn

CSS và HTML tốt nhất nên được giữ riêng biệt để CSS có thể truy cập thống nhất đối với tất cả các trang trên một trang web, không chỉ tài liệu mà nó được đưa vào. Tích hợp CSS vào các trang web là một cách không hiệu quả để tạo kiểu trang web

Có ba cách để kết hợp CSS

  1. tệp bên ngoài
  2. phong cách nhúng
  3. kiểu nội tuyến

Tính đặc hiệu của các kiểu nội tuyến khiến chúng nằm ngoài tầm với khi ghi đè chúng. !important có thể hiệu quả, nhưng cũng có thể không. Vì lý do này, chúng tôi tránh các kiểu nội tuyến như bệnh dịch hạch. Chúng ngỗ ngược, bừa bộn và là một lực cản hoàn toàn khi chúng đứng lên

Các kiểu được nhúng trong tầng thấp hơn so với các tệp bên ngoài, vì vậy sẽ (hoặc có thể) ghi đè các quy tắc CSS bên ngoài nếu chúng thực hiện cùng một lựa chọn. Một lần nữa, chúng nằm trong trang và có thể gây ra một số sự cố khi chúng tôi cố gắng tạo một chủ đề nhất quán trên một trang web. Sự lặp lại trong một số tài liệu là một dấu hiệu tốt cho thấy nó nên có trong biểu định kiểu bên ngoài


Embedded style sheet

Đối ngoại là cách tốt nhất để đảm bảo tính thống nhất, hiệu quả và đồng nhất. Viết nó một lần và sử dụng nó ở mọi nơi. Cần phải thay đổi một cái gì đó? . Đơn giản, hiệu quả và tiết kiệm thời gian

HTML (Ngôn ngữ đánh dấu siêu văn bản) và CSS (Cascading Style Sheets) là hai trong số những công nghệ cốt lõi để xây dựng các trang Web. HTML cung cấp cấu trúc của trang, CSS bố cục (hình ảnh và âm thanh), cho nhiều loại thiết bị. Cùng với đồ họa và tập lệnh, HTML và CSS là cơ sở để xây dựng các trang Web và Ứng dụng Web. Tìm hiểu thêm bên dưới về

HTML là gì?

HTML là ngôn ngữ để mô tả cấu trúc của các trang Web. HTML cung cấp cho tác giả phương tiện để

  • Xuất bản tài liệu trực tuyến với tiêu đề, văn bản, bảng, danh sách, ảnh, v.v.
  • Truy xuất thông tin trực tuyến qua các liên kết siêu văn bản, chỉ bằng một nút bấm
  • Thiết kế các biểu mẫu để thực hiện giao dịch với các dịch vụ từ xa, để sử dụng cho việc tìm kiếm thông tin, đặt chỗ, đặt hàng sản phẩm, v.v.
  • Bao gồm bảng tính, video clip, clip âm thanh và các ứng dụng khác trực tiếp trong tài liệu của họ

Với HTML, tác giả mô tả cấu trúc của các trang bằng cách sử dụng đánh dấu. Các thành phần của nhãn ngôn ngữ các phần nội dung như “đoạn văn”, “danh sách”, “bảng”, v.v.

XHTML là gì?

XHTML là một biến thể của HTML sử dụng cú pháp của XML, Ngôn ngữ đánh dấu mở rộng. XHTML có tất cả các phần tử giống nhau (đối với đoạn văn, v.v. ) dưới dạng biến thể HTML, nhưng cú pháp hơi khác một chút. Vì XHTML là một ứng dụng XML nên bạn có thể sử dụng các công cụ XML khác với nó (chẳng hạn như XSLT, một ngôn ngữ để chuyển đổi nội dung XML)

CSS là gì?

CSS là ngôn ngữ để mô tả cách trình bày của các trang Web, bao gồm màu sắc, bố cục và phông chữ. Nó cho phép một người thích ứng bản trình bày với các loại thiết bị khác nhau, chẳng hạn như màn hình lớn, màn hình nhỏ hoặc máy in. CSS độc lập với HTML và có thể được sử dụng với bất kỳ ngôn ngữ đánh dấu dựa trên XML nào. Việc tách HTML khỏi CSS giúp dễ dàng duy trì các trang web, chia sẻ biểu định kiểu giữa các trang và điều chỉnh các trang cho phù hợp với các môi trường khác nhau. Điều này được gọi là sự phân tách cấu trúc (hoặc. nội dung) từ bản trình bày

WebFont là gì?

WebFonts là một công nghệ cho phép mọi người sử dụng phông chữ theo yêu cầu trên Web mà không cần cài đặt trong hệ điều hành. W3C có kinh nghiệm về các phông chữ có thể tải xuống thông qua HTML, CSS2 và SVG. Cho đến gần đây, các phông chữ có thể tải xuống vẫn chưa phổ biến trên Web do thiếu định dạng phông chữ có thể tương tác. Nỗ lực của WebFonts có kế hoạch giải quyết vấn đề đó thông qua việc tạo định dạng phông chữ mở, được ngành hỗ trợ cho Web (được gọi là "WOFF")

ví dụ

Ví dụ rất đơn giản sau đây về một phần của tài liệu HTML minh họa cách tạo liên kết trong một đoạn văn. Khi được hiển thị trên màn hình (hoặc bằng bộ tổng hợp giọng nói), văn bản liên kết sẽ là “báo cáo cuối cùng”; . //www. thí dụ. com/báo cáo”

For more information see the final report.

Thuộc tính class trên thẻ bắt đầu của đoạn (“

”) có thể được sử dụng, trong số những thứ khác, để thêm phong cách. Chẳng hạn, để in nghiêng văn bản của tất cả các đoạn văn bằng một lớp “moreinfo”, người ta có thể viết, bằng CSS

Làm cách nào để sử dụng CSS và HTML trong cùng một tệp?

Chúng tôi sẽ bắt đầu với một biểu định kiểu được nhúng bên trong tệp HTML. Sau đó, chúng tôi sẽ đặt HTML và CSS trong các tệp riêng biệt. Các tệp riêng biệt là tốt vì việc sử dụng cùng một biểu định kiểu cho nhiều tệp HTML sẽ dễ dàng hơn. bạn chỉ phải viết biểu định kiểu một lần

HTML CSS và JavaScript hoạt động cùng nhau như thế nào?

HTML, CSS và JavaScript phối hợp với nhau để tạo thành thiết kế mặt trước của trang web bằng cách áp dụng thông tin ảnh hưởng đến nội dung, phong cách và tính tương tác của trang web. Vì vậy, không chỉ có một ngôn ngữ web?

Việc sử dụng CSS trong HTML là gì?

CSS saves a lot of work. It can control the layout of multiple web pages all at once. CSS can be added to HTML elements in 3 ways: Inline - by using the style attribute in HTML elements. Internal - by using a Two options: 1, add css inline like style="background:black" Or 2. In the head include the css as a style tag block.

Tôi nên học HTML và CSS riêng biệt hay cùng nhau?

Mặc dù thông thường các nhà thiết kế và nhà phát triển Web có tham vọng nên học cách đọc và viết mã HTML trước , điều đó không có nghĩa là bạn . Nếu không có CSS, các trang của bạn sẽ bị giới hạn trực quan đối với các thẻ định dạng và phong cách có sẵn trong HTML và gần đây là HTML5.

HTML và CSS được gọi cùng nhau là gì?

DHTML có nghĩa là HTML động —chính xác là sự kết hợp của mã HTML/JavaScript/CSS.

HTML và CSS có tốt để bắt đầu không?

Là ngôn ngữ phát triển web cơ bản HTML và CSS là một cách tuyệt vời để bắt đầu phát triển . Điều này là do các ngôn ngữ này cung cấp các bộ quy tắc đơn giản xác định cách viết mã và dễ học.